jwbf.net
当前位置:首页 >> x%1 >>

x%1

>>是右移运算符。 = 1 等同于 x = x/2; 这是位运算, >>左移运算,> n 等同于 x / (2^n) x

C语言中的任何一个双目运算符(就是和2个数做运算的运算符,比如一些数学运算符,逻辑运算符,关系运算符,位运算符)都可以和赋值运算符在一起组成“复合的赋值运算符”。 具体运算规则如下: x - = 1 左边保留变量x,然后把赋值左边的变量和运算...

只有当 x 等于 -1 时 ( x+1) 等于 0, 只有这时 !(x+1) -- 非 0 得 真。 当 x 不等于 -1 时, x+1 不等于 0, 不等于 0 是 TRUE(真), !(x+1) 得 FALSE.(假) 因此: if ( !(x+1) { } else { }; if (x == -1) { } else { }; 这两句里 的 !(x+1)...

关键知识点:./ 指的是矩阵各元素分别计算 例如 a = [2 3]; b = 1./ab为[1/2 1/3],而1/a则表示a的逆。所以 x=1.╱(1+x.*x)就表示分别让x的每个元素都进行x(i)=1╱(1+x(i)*x(i))运算 例如 clcclear allclose all%--- 程序段1 ---%x = [1 2 3...

x

x[i]=-1的意思是对x数组的第i+1个元素赋值为-1; 值得注意的是数组下标从0开始,并且取到的下标最大值为数组长度-1。 示例代码: #include int main(){ int x[10], i;//声明数组x和变量i for (i = 0; i < 10; ++i){//遍历数组元素的循环[0-10),...

不明白你说的配方是要化成怎样... 求最小值直接用基本不等式 y = x + 1/x >= 2*根号(x*1/x) = 2 最小值为2

执行一次,因为执行一次后 x=1,而!x就表示假了。 !表示取反的意思,!ture为false。 而x=1表示true。

y=(x+1)+1/(x+1)-1 当x+1>0时 (x+1)+1/(x+1)>=2 ∴y>=1 当x+1

解: y=1/(x-1)+1 y=x/(x-1) x=-4、y=4/5; x=-3、y=3/4; x=-2、y=2/3; x=-1、y=1/2; x=0、y=0; x=1/2、y=-1; x=3/4、y=-3; x=7/8、y=-7; x=9/8、y=9; x=5/4、y=5; x=3/2、y=3; x=2、y=2; x=3、y=3/2; x=4、y=4/3; x=5、y=5/4; x=...

网站首页 | 网站地图
All rights reserved Powered by www.jwbf.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com